掌握加密货币钱包源码的使用秘籍:从入门到精
什么是加密货币钱包源码?
想要理解加密货币钱包源码,首先得知道什么是加密货币钱包。简单来说,加密货币钱包就像你的银行账户,用来存储和管理你的虚拟货币。这些钱包的源码,则是它们的程序代码,是开发者创建和管理钱包的基础。有些人会好奇,源码难不难用?哎,这事儿就得看你使用的目的了。
基础知识:源码和钱包的关系
每一个钱包都有自己的源码,这些源码包含了钱包的功能,如生成地址、发送和接收虚拟货币、查看余额等等。如果你有编程基础,那就简单了,你可以直接修改源码,定制适合自己的钱包。如果你没啥基础,那也不必着急,这世界上总有人愿意分享经验。
选择合适的源码
市场上有很多开源的钱包源码,比如Bitcoin Core、MyEtherWallet、Trust Wallet等。选择源码的时候,最好挑选那些活跃度高、社区支持强的项目。社区大,问题就更容易得到解决,学习资源也更丰富。比如说,GitHub上有很多开发者积极维护项目,你只需要搜索一下,就能找到大量的教程和问题解答。
如何使用加密货币钱包源码?
说到使用钱包源码,首先你得知道如何搭建环境。我还是以最流行的比特币钱包为例吧。准备好Node.js和npm(包管理工具),然后从GitHub上克隆下载钱包源码就行。
不过这里有个小插曲,有些朋友在这一步就卡住了。他们不太懂Node.js是个啥,其实可以把它想象成一个工具箱,帮助你管理代码的工具。只要跟着教程下载和安装就好了,网上有很多详细的视频教程。
编译源码
下载完成后,你需要对源码进行编译。这一步有点技术含量,但其实不复杂。很多项目会提供编译的步骤。在Linux上,你通常需要打开终端,进入到源码目录,执行一些命令,比如“make”或者“./autogen.sh”。中间如果碰到错误,不用担心,谷歌搜索一下错误信息,很多时候能找到解决办法。
配置钱包
编译完成后,你得配置钱包。不同的钱包可能有不同的配置方法,有些需要修改配置文件,有些则通过命令行参数传递配置。比如说,你可能需要指定节点地址、设置API密钥等等。千万别慌,把官方文档认真的看一遍,通常会有详细说明。
测试钱包
一切设置完成后,先别急着用你的钱包进行真实交易。先在测试网(Testnet)上试试!测试网是一个模拟的环境,完全不涉及真实的金钱,安全性强,能帮助你熟悉钱包的功能。进行些发送、接收交易,测试一下,体验体验。而且,这种实践能让你对操作流程更加熟悉。
注意安全问题
说到这里,安全问题就得提一提。用加密货币钱包源码做交易,首先要确保你的私钥安全。不要把私钥和助记词随便放在网上,很多时候一个小失误,就有可能导致损失惨重。别忘了,即便是高手,安全意识也不能放松。最近有个朋友就是因为私钥没保管好,损失了一大笔钱,听得我心寒。
学习资源和社区支持
你可能会问,哪里有学习资源?很多颜色的书籍、在线课程,甚至YouTube上也有许多专业博主分享经验。可以加入一些开发者社群,交流经验,互相帮助。在这里,你能找到志同道合的小伙伴,或许还能学到一些冷门的技巧。
自己的项目实践
理解源码后,为什么不试着做个自己的项目呢?从头到尾自己搭建一个钱包,可能会遇到很多问题,但这正是成长的过程。随着你不断解决问题,技术水平也会突飞猛进。想象一下,经过努力,自己打造的加密货币钱包上线了,这种成就感,真的是无与伦比!
总结心得
整体来说,使用加密货币钱包源码并不是太难的事情。只要你有耐心,愿意花时间去钻研,相信你一定能掌握这门技能。加密货币的未来充满机会,懂得技术的人,才能在这个新兴领域中把握先机。记得遇到问题不要灰心,随时可以向社区求助,相信总能找到解决办法。
好啦,今天就聊到这,希望对你有帮助。如果你在使用钱包源码上有什么其他问题,或者有趣的经验,别忘了分享哦!一起学习一起进步,未来的科技世界属于我们每一个热爱探索的人!